14kg heroin seized near Pathankot, one arrested
Pathankot, May 15 (UNI) A man was arrested here after 14 kg of heroin worth about Rs 14 crore in the international market was seized from his possession near Sarna village of this district last night, Directorate of Revenue Intelligence sources said here today.
According to official sources, counterfeit Indian currency worth Rs 7.99 lakh were also seized from the man, Harbhagwan Singh, who was carrying the contraband from Jammu in his jeep bound for Amritsar.
The fake notes were of Rs 1000 denomination amounting Rs three lakh while the rest were of Rs 500 denomination, the sources added.
The man, hailing from Amritsar district's Bhikhivind village, was nabbed when the contraband, hidden in a secret chamber in his vehicle, was recovered during the routine checking at a check post near village Sarna at Jammu-Delhi Highway, DRI sources said.
Harbhagwan Singh was being interrogated further, they added.
